Short bio

I am the Co-founder of Ethertify, a startup company aimed at building an open and decentralized certification platform on top of Ethereum and IPFS.

Before, I was a post-doctoral researcher in the MYRIADS research group, a joined team between IRISA (Institut de recherche en informatique et systèmes aléatoires) and Inria. My position is founded by the University of Rennes though the HARNESS European project.

I received my Ph. D. degree in computer science from the Universidad Politécnica de Madrid (Spain) in 2010 in the Distributed systems Lab (LSD) under the supervision of by Marta Patiño-Martínez, co-director of the laboratory. My thesis was founded by Microsoft Research Cambridge under the European PhD Scholarship Programme. After defending my PhD thesis, I spent two years as a post-doctoral researcher in the SARDES project, part of Inria and LIG (Laboratoire d'Informatique de Grenoble) in Grenoble, France and two years in the ERODS research group, founded by the University of Grenoble I - UJF. My research focused in designing and developing cloud services that are able to provide improved Quality-of-Service (QoS) guarantees.

Research systems

I am a contributor to the following research systems:

  • MRBS: MapReduce performance and dependability benchmarking suite
  • MoKa: Modeling and capacity planning of cluster-based multi-tier data centers
  • Middle-R: Middleware for Scalable Database Replication (available under request)
  • e-Caching: consistent multi-tier cache (available under request)

Teaching software

  • GView: Interactive tool to teach backtracking, greedy and map-reduce algorithms. Used in classes given by members of the Department of Software Engineering (Technical University of Madrid). (Available under request)
  • Geocomp: Interactive tool to teach how to build triangulations of a point set. Used in classes given by membres of the Department of Mathematics (Technical University of Madrid).
